Skip to content

Commit 08f26b4

Browse files
committed
Backport evalpts property
1 parent 2ef0e90 commit 08f26b4

File tree

1 file changed

+16
-0
lines changed

1 file changed

+16
-0
lines changed

geomdl/BSpline.py

Lines changed: 16 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-56,6 +56,14 @@ def __call__(self, degree, ctrlpts, knotvector):
5656
self.ctrlpts = ctrlpts
5757
self.knotvector = knotvector
5858

59+
@property
60+
def evalpts(self):
61+
""" Evaluated points.
62+
63+
:getter: Gets the coordinates of the evaluated points
64+
"""
65+
return self.curvepts
66+
5967
@property
6068
def ctrlpts(self):
6169
""" Control points.
@@ -916,6 +924,14 @@ def __call__(self, degree_u, degree_v, ctrlpts_size_u, ctrlpts_size_v, ctrlpts,
916924
self.knotvector_u = knotvector_u
917925
self.knotvector_v = knotvector_v
918926

927+
@property
928+
def evalpts(self):
929+
""" Evaluated points.
930+
931+
:getter: Gets the coordinates of the evaluated points
932+
"""
933+
return self.surfpts
934+
919935
@property
920936
def ctrlpts(self):
921937
""" 1D Control points.

0 commit comments

Comments
 (0)